Entering this week, pitcher Joey Magrisi of state No. 9 Torrey Pines is sitting between David Wells and Cole Hamels in the CIF San Diego Section record book for consecutive scoreless innings pitched. His team also moved up five spots. Photo: Twitter.com.


Bizarro world situations continue to emerge for this year’s rankings as Bellarmine of San Jose (which has six league losses) wins the Boras Classic state championship while a San Mateo Serra team that is the round-robin co-champion of that same league drops a pair of non-league games. It’s still calm at the top, however, as Harvard-Westlake, Eastlake, Huntington Beach and Arcadia had no problems last week.
